Output 8680d4e72459f107962872ca84a05289dba178870229f156b5b377ffd7d1e478:0

value
3527600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ae612d4ffcfc308a230b11eb7012afc342f0f42 OP_EQUALVERIFY OP_CHECKSIG
address
14upzrCYESnxJ83raCBkb5rqYp9PsGjP76
transaction
8680d4e72459f107962872ca84a05289dba178870229f156b5b377ffd7d1e478
spent
true